Market Size and Overview
The Global Electronic Warfare Market size is estimated to be valued at USD 19.56 billion in 2026 and is expected to reach USD 29.43 billion by 2033, exhibiting a CAGR of 6.0% from 2026 to 2033.
This growth reflects increasing investments in defense infrastructure and the rising integration of advanced electronic warfare systems across both land and naval platforms. Impact of Geopolitical Situation on Supply Chain
A notable use case illustrating geopolitical impact on the electronic warfare market supply chain occurred in early 2025 when ongoing geopolitical tensions in Eastern Europe disrupted the transit of crucial EW system components through Black Sea ports.
This led key suppliers to reroute shipments via longer, costlier pathways, resulting in delayed deliveries and increased costs. As a consequence, market companies had to recalibrate inventory strategies and increase buffer stocks, which temporarily restrained market growth but accelerated the shift toward diversified supplier networks—a critical factor shaping market trends and long-term resilience.
